Meta's Vision and Investment in AI
Meta, formerly known as Facebook, has been focusing heavily on integrating AI into its ecosystem. From enhancing user experiences on social platforms like Facebook and Instagram to developing cutting-edge AI models for broader applications, the company is investing heavily in this technology. In 2025 alone, Meta plans to allocate up to $65 billion for AI infrastructure expansion. This massive investment underscores Meta's commitment to AI as a cornerstone of its future business strategy.
The Open-Source AI Strategy
Mark Zuckerberg has been vocal about his belief in the potential of open-source AI. During a recent conference call, he emphasized the importance of establishing an open-source standard for AI globally, advocating for an American-led initiative. This approach aims to democratize AI technology, allowing developers worldwide to access and contribute to AI advancements, fostering innovation and collaboration.
Navigating Global Competition
The launch of DeepSeek's AI models has sparked concerns among investors and competitors alike. DeepSeek claims its models can match or even surpass those of major US companies like Meta, all while operating at a fraction of the cost. This development has raised questions about the scalability of AI without exorbitant investments in computing power.
Meta's response to this challenge is multifaceted. While acknowledging the innovative strides made by DeepSeek, Zuckerberg remains optimistic about Meta's AI initiatives. The company is keen to learn from competitors and integrate valuable insights into its own products, potentially reducing costs and increasing efficiency.
Balancing Investor Expectations and Innovation
Meta's ambitious spending plans have not gone unnoticed by investors. While the company's fourth-quarter revenue exceeded Wall Street expectations, projections for the upcoming quarter have been met with mixed reactions. With expected revenues ranging between $39.5 billion and $41.8 billion, slightly below analyst estimates, there is cautious optimism about the company's AI trajectory.
The key question facing Meta is whether its substantial AI investments will yield the desired returns. Jeremy Goldman, a principal analyst at eMarketer, notes that while ad revenues remain a significant source of income, the real test for Meta is whether its AI infrastructure investments will pay off in the long term.
The Future of AI-Driven Business Solutions
Meta's AI journey is not just about technological advancements; it's about reshaping the business landscape. With over 1.3 million graphics processors and a gigawatt of computing power expected to be online by year-end, Meta is positioning itself as a leader in AI-driven solutions.
The company's focus extends beyond social media, encompassing metaverse technologies such as smart glasses and augmented reality systems. These innovations aim to revolutionize how users interact with technology, offering immersive experiences and new business opportunities.
